Moslem Anatouf: Algeria's wonderkid models his game after Victor Osimhen

“He was wanted by every club in Algeria, but also abroad, where he already has an excellent reputation,” Mohamed Mekhazni said. Mekhazni is the director of sport at MC Algier and he is talking about talent Moslem Anatouf, who joined the Ligue Professionelle 1, which is currently at the top of the table this summer from the Algerian football academy. The 17-year-old is yet to make his debut, but expectations are high for the striker.

“I try to learn from every player,” Anatouf said in an interview with Transfermarkt. “I watch many of them, but mostly Victor Osimhen, who is very strong at the moment, and Erling Haaland.” Like Osimhen and Haaland, Anatouf is a typical center-forward. Athletic, fast, technically gifted, two-footed, and dangerous in front of the goal—he has plenty of quality. But Algier head coach Moussa Dahman likes one attribute: “Moslem anticipates very well,” Dahman said. “He has this ability to foresee what defenders will do next and is always a step ahead. I am convinced that it is that skill that will make him into a great striker.”

Born in Tindouf, Algeria, the striker always tries to improve daily. “He always keeps on learning,” Dahman said. “He keeps asking me questions in training. He wants to learn and add new knowledge, and despite his age, he is always on top of any information and analysis.” Mekhazni agrees with his head coach. “The attribute that stands out to me and assures me about Moslem’s future is his mentality,” Mekhazni said. “He is like a sponge, always ready to suck up new information. But he also takes advice, corrects himself, and always questions himself. You get the impression that you are dealing with a player with ten years of experience. I think he has the qualities for a big career.”


Despite all that, Anatouf has yet to play for the first team. The baptism of fire has been postponed because of two injuries and the nomination to Algeria’s U20 national team. “It only has been five or six months since he arrived,” Mekhazni said. “We want to plan his integration in an intelligent matter. We don’t want to hasten things. It will happen naturally.”

The club, however, is aware that the transition to the first team will be an essential stepping stone in a young player’s career. “What is lacking is the competitive toughness, which would give him the maturity on a personal and team level,” Dahman said. “He has to get first-team minutes in his legs against experienced players; the goal has to be to get playing time, and then we will see. But all that will come.” 


Anatouf hasn’t been inpatient either; instead, he remains grounded with both feet on the floor. “First of all, I have to establish myself in the first team and the first Algerian division,” Anatouf said. “I have to improve in many areas to play in Europe; the level there is much higher than in Algeria.” Anatouf has one goal in particular: “My dream is to play for my country at a major competition,” Anatouf said. “At the World Cup, for example. Or why not win the Africa Cup?” Anatouf may not have played first-team minutes yet, but he is certainly ambitious.
